What Causes a Dripping Faucet and How to Fix It?

Why a Dripping Faucet Shouldn’t Be Ignored That steady drip from your kitchen or bathroom sink isn’t just irritating—it’s wasteful. According to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, one drip per second can waste more than 3,000 gallons of water per year. That’s water (and money) literally going down the drain.
